4-2-3-1 again? How Liverpool could line-up against Midtjylland

Jurgen Klopp opted to switch from his tried and tested 4-3-3 formation at the weekend, and he could do so again in Europe

Jurgen Klopp could be set to hand a Champions League starting debut to Diogo Jota after the Portuguese scored the winning goal against Sheffield Utd on Saturday.

Against the Blades, Klopp changed from a 4-3-3 to a 4-2-3-1 in order to accommodate Jota alongside the usual trio of Sadio Mane, Mohamed Salah, and Roberto Firmino.

Should the German decide against resting any of those four players against a team they should very easily be defeating in Midtjylland, that's the formation they will play on Tuesday.

After a spurt of injuries issues, Liverpool were thought to have had Thiago and Joel Matip back for this one, but the pair, along with Naby Keita, are out according to Klopp

Fabinho has excelled in the centre-back position in Virgil van Dijk's absence, and will feature there again if Matip is still out.

With the Brazilian in defence and Thiago and Keita out, the midfield pairing will probably be Gini Wijnaldum and Jordan Henderson.

Alisson was welcomed back straight into the starting XI against Sheffield Utd and will make his first Champions League appearance of the season on Tuesday.
